SXSW Film also brings it hard with a keynote session presented by Academy Award-nominated actress Ellen Page. The world premiere of Everybody Wants Some, the long anticipated follow up to Dazed and Confused by director/screenwriter Richard Linklater is also slated this year.
For those patrons who are more tech-savvy, SXSW Interactive has a torrent of events scheduled as well. Check out The Making Of: How to Create iTunes Extras panel, which focuses on how to create and upload digital bonus content to your iTunes media. Of course, it goes without saying that you will also want to check out POTUS Barack Obama as he discusses how to bring the United States into the 21st century tech-driven world and beyond.
Over the past years, as any festival does, SXSW has undergone some scrutiny. Too much of a good thing will invariably draw criticism. That is why it is important to remember the basic principle the festival was founded on: to serve as a tool for creative people to develop their careers by bringing people together from around the globe to meet, learn and share ideas.
